The project is about the design, programming, physical implementation and commissioning of three laboratory practices for a SIEMENS SIMATIC Programmable Logic Controller (PLC) coded in STEP-7 ladder language. One practice is on the start-stop latching logic for activating an output; the second one is on uploading a simple program to the PLC hardware; and the last one is on creating a ladder diagram via timer & counter units.
